			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>There are times in life when one is made to appreciate the little things. When a previously overlooked, seemingly unimportant part of the world suddenly takes on a new meaning and strange urgency.</p>
<p>This week, that part of the world for me has been ceilings.</p>
<p>Ceilings are almost the very definition of &#8216;things that I don&#8217;t think about&#8217;. As a general rule, I don&#8217;t look up. I expect most people are the same in this respect, which is why it&#8217;s so easy to capture them in net traps set up to fall in their hallways when they come home.</p>
<p>Anyway. This week the ceiling in my bedroom decided that it wanted a change of perspective of its own, and would rather be on the floor, which forced me to contemplate the concept of the ceiling properly for the first time.</p>
<p>Interestingly, it turns out that I have no idea how they work. Many people have asked me searching questions about water damage (there was none), joists (yep, some were there), plasterboard (not sure how that differs to plaster, I&#8217;m not convinced there even was any) and I have thus been forced to bluff my way through several conversations made up entirely of ceiling-based jargon in order not to appear an utterly incompetent failure of a human being.</p>
<p>&#8220;Can you imagine not even knowing how <em>ceilings</em> work?! I mean, how does one even fall off in the first place! What an idiot!&#8221;</p>
<p>I imagine people have been thinking things much along these lines. It would only be reasonable for them to do so, I&#8217;m sure.</p>
<p>So. I&#8217;ve been living on the floor of the lounge for nearly ten days, and becoming increasingly obsessed by the slow state of ceiling repair, and dreaming of those halcyon days when I didn&#8217;t think about ceilings at <em>all</em>.</p>
<p>My dreams have been haunted by falling masonry, and I was forced to give up a playthrough of the Legend of Zelda when the floor in the temple rose up and attacked me as I feared it would make my nightmares even worse.</p>
<p>Luckily I&#8217;ve discovered that my laptop works outdoors and so I&#8217;m writing this from the street. I think I can probably manage without going indoors anymore for a good few years, by which time I&#8217;m banking that ceiling technology will have improved to the point where this will never happen again.</p>
<p>Otherwise, I think I&#8217;ve taken the experience rather well.</p>
<p>I have to go now.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s starting to rain and I need the laptop for shelter.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Dear Ealing Council,</p>
<p>I am writing to thank you from the bottom of my heart for rejecting my appeal against the £100 fine you so justly served me with for picking up my friends from the train station on the morning of the 3rd May 2010.</p>
<p>As your CCTV cameras quite rightly spotted, I was indeed stopped outside the station between the hours of 11:14am and 11:15am on the morning in question. During this period a whole 60 seconds passed, an unacceptable length of time to be anywhere without the proper authorisation. Who knows what the consequences may have been if I had stayed for even a moment longer?</p>
<p>I&#8217;d like to thank you in particular for opening my eyes to the feebleness of my excuses. I now understand that the fact that the car park immediately outside the station was being dug up is no excuse whatsoever &#8211; in fact I am surprised and delighted to learn that it is in actuality a private car park!</p>
<p>I see now that the assumption that the car park right outside the station was some sort of pick-up/drop-off car park as exists at virtually every busy train station in the country is laughable, and I am embarrassed that I thought that this is what the car park was for.</p>
<p>Thank you also for pointing out that there is a designated pick-up/drop-off point elsewhere which I was similarly unaware of. Having only lived in Ealing for 18 months I must seem like quite a tourist to never have noticed this. How you must have laughed! In future I shall be sure to take advantage of this facility, or one of the many other convenient and affordable parking options in central Ealing. Or I&#8217;ll just tell my friends to walk.</p>
<p>I now know that when confronted with a closed car park (which I quite hilariously believed to be for the purpose of picking people up from the station) I should not have hovered, confused and unsure as to where to go, and should certainly not have paused and waved my friends over, allowed them into my car and continued on my way.</p>
<p>All of this is my way of saying that I thoroughly deserve my £100 fine for being unsure what to do for a whole 60 seconds. As a proud citizen of Ealing I should never be uncertain, and your fine is really a way of helping me to be a better person by teaching me this lesson.</p>
<p>Of course, I&#8217;m not just writing this letter to praise you for your excellent service (and I haven&#8217;t even yet mentioned the speedy turnaround time of 35 days between my submitting the appeal and you rejecting it!). As much as I&#8217;m sure you love your fanmail, I believe that every good deed deserves a return, and so I would like to inform you that I now intend to hold you to the same high standards as you do me.</p>
<p>As such I will now consider it my duty to inform Ealing Council whenever your service falls beneath your own high standards for 60 seconds. I have made a form to post to you &#8211; in this unlikely eventuality &#8211; which will explain exactly where you went wrong during that minute, along with payment details so you can send me the appropriate fine (though I believe we have established a precedent that a 60 second mistake is worth £100, which seems eminently fair to me).</p>
<p>So anytime you take more than sixty seconds to answer your phone (or even fail to answer it at all, as has happened so often this past few weeks as I have attempted to find out how the detectives working on my case are proceeding with the complex appeals process), or fail to collect the rubbish in a timely manner, or run over budget, or make some tiny administrative error, or indeed anything at all that falls short of the unbelievable service I have come to expect from you, I shall inform you of how much I am expecting you to pay in compensation.</p>
<p>There is no need to thank me for helping you to improve yourselves in this way &#8211; after all, you&#8217;ve done it for me and others so many times.</p>
<p>Naturally, as a mere private citizen I don&#8217;t expect you to actually pay me any money. What kind of world would we be living in if people could just slap fines on each other willy-nilly for any tiny mistake?! And as a mere private citizen I understand it is my duty to lie back and take whatever corrective punishment you see fit for my misdemeanours, and that this is not at all a two-way arrangement. As I have made clear in this letter I am very grateful for this, and feel lucky to live in Ealing. After all, I could have been born in communist East Germany, with faceless bureaucrats using cameras to spy on my every move. Imagine how awful that would be!</p>
<p>Lastly, this whole episode has given me an idea for a slogan you might wish to adopt. I have no idea if you are looking for one at the moment, but in case you are I shall offer it to you free of charge:</p>
<p><em>&#8220;Ealing Council: Technically Correct But Morally Wrong&#8221;.</em></p>
<p>Thank you so much again. I am sure there are wrongdoers attempting to innocently go about their everyday lives even as we speak, so I&#8217;ll use up no more of your precious time.</p>
<p>Yours, in everlasting gratitude,<br />
Neil Hughes</p>
<p>PS Your website timed out on me this morning when I was looking for your address. There&#8217;s a form in the post &#8211; that&#8217;ll be £100 please. Though if you pay by next week we&#8217;ll call it £50. Thanks.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><em>&#8230; &amp; idiots tell us &#8216;what markets want to hear&#8217;.</em></p>
<p>I have so far resisted blogging on the election, or the post-election negotiations. And even now that it looks like it&#8217;s about to be settled with the Lib Dems getting behind Cameron as PM I&#8217;m not going to comment on that. Or on the failures of our voting system and the obvious need for reform.</p>
<p>But I have been moved to comment more fully on the constant stream of morons selectively interpret the markets to validate their every opinion.</p>
<p>Examples abound, but fearmongering over a hung parliament reached feverish levels over the weekend, with the Sun&#8217;s Monday morning edition proclaiming castastrophe in the City as Gordon Brown clung on to power.</p>
<p>Strangely on Tuesday after the markets had risen 5% they didn&#8217;t retract, apologise for or even mention their previous bleating on the subject.</p>
<p>No, when interpreting the markets you can feel free to ignore any evidence that contradicts your assertion. In fact it&#8217;s encouraged!</p>
<p>Even worse, following Gordon Brown&#8217;s pre-resignation announcement last night the markets have dropped today. Has anyone come out and said that Brown should have stayed on and that the markets clearly <em>wanted</em> a progressive &#8216;Rainbow&#8217; coalition? No, of course not; for some reason this selective tea-leaf reading of the markets appears to be a peculiarly right-wing condition.</p>
<p>Impressively, some people have today claimed that this market drop is some kind of punishment for voting liberal! Why the markets took five days to notice, or how they tell what is specifically due to liberal voting wasn&#8217;t made entirely clear. But they know, make no mistake.</p>
<p>Do what we tell you or the market will get you!</p>
<p>I&#8217;m reminded of the various arms of the US Republicans immediately following Obama&#8217;s election, who at various times predicted market chaos or reacted with glee whenever the market dropped in the months between his election and his inauguration: each time someone proclaimed it was due to something Obama had said or done or was planning to do. Eighteen months into his presidency the markets are way up (even taking into account last week&#8217;s computer glitch weirdness). Are those same pundits apologising and promising to vote Obama next time?</p>
<p>No, because they were being disingenuous in the first place when linking the &#8211; partly random &#8211; market movements with their own political agenda.</p>
<p>Let&#8217;s finish with a quick hint for anyone looking to get into the armchair market punditry business. When interpreting markets to your own ends it&#8217;s important to remember that markets only care about what <em>you</em> care about. If you think the markets want David Cameron then they do want David Cameron!</p>
<p>Some of my more international readers may be feeling a little left out here. The real beauty of the system is that you can substitute John McCain, Kevin Rudd, or your world politican of choice &#8211; as a selective market interpreteer [sic] you are encouraged to forget about all the world events and just view them with your local country filter on.</p>
<p>Everyone knows markets don&#8217;t care about financial meltdown in Greece, massive oil spills off the coast of the US, wars, or even business conditions. They simply care about the local political issues that YOU care about (except when things are going contrary to your prediction when something else is happening, probably those nasty liberal voters!)</p>
<p>Anyway, now that Cameron is nearly in place we can probably forget about all of this. I&#8217;m reliably assured by our national media that the markets absolutely <em>love</em> him and just can&#8217;t wait for this nasty hung parliament business to be over with. So that&#8217;s alright then.</p>
<p>&#8212;&#8211;</p>
<p><em>A note on the partisanship of this post:</em></p>
<p><em>This isn&#8217;t intended as an attack on Cameron as he stands poised to take power. Let&#8217;s see what he does before judging!</em></p>
<p><em>It&#8217;s simply a plea for people to stop cherry-picking market based evidence in an effort to support your their views.</em></p>
<p><em>Markets are inherently complex, chaotic systems, and are almost never governed by simple explanations or predictions. A little understanding of chaos theory goes a long way: small inputs can have big effects and big inputs can have small effects.</em></p>
<p><em>So please. Wrap. Up.</em></p>
